WebbHow much tax do you pay on 401k withdrawal? If you withdraw funds early from a 401(k), you will be charged a 10% penalty. You will also need to pay an income tax rate on the amount you withdraw, since pre-tax dollars were used to fund the account. In short, if you withdraw retirement funds early, the money will be treated as income. Webb18 mars 2024 · Once you reach age 59.5, you may withdraw money from your 401(k) penalty-free.
